Show modern player card
Name Team Age
John Brady Retired (2030, Age 34) Died (2073, Age 78)
Drafted Position Bats/Throws
Round 3, Pick 45
(2016)
SS R/R
League Option Years   Majors Service Time
Harmon Killebrew League 0 5 years (12 games)
Total Rating   Arm Range
A+ B-
Contact vs R Contact vs L Speed
B+
Power vs R Power vs L Bunting
B+ B- D+
Endurance Velocity Control
B- D- D-
Leadership   Mentor vs RHP   Mentor vs LHP  
C+ A+ A+
Health   Injured Days   Birthday
B+ 0 11/23/1995
WS Rings WS Appearances LCS Appearances
0 0 0
Alt Pos (SS) Alt Pos (2B) Alt Pos (1B)
A+ (97.5 %) B+ (75.3 %) D- (7.3 %)

Stats  |   Splits  |   Playoffs  |   Positions  |   Improvements  |   Past Skills  |   Awards   |  Fielding   |  Game Log
Date Opponent AB R H 2B 3B HR RBI BB SO SB CS E OPS OBP SLG AVG
Show All Games from This Season
Career Transactions
DateTransaction
2030-11-01John Brady has retired from the Free Agency Pool
2030-06-16The New York Giants have waived John Brady.
2030-06-01The New York Giants have promoted Dick Koehler to the major league team. The New York Giants have designated John Brady for assignment.
2029-04-01The New York Giants have promoted John Brady to the major league team. The New York Giants have designated Lee Bushing for assignment.
2028-06-15The New York Giants have acquired John Brady from the waiver wire.
2027-08-03The Colorado Pirates have waived John Brady.
2027-07-05The Colorado Pirates have designated John Brady for assignment.
2024-04-21The Colorado Pirates have promoted John Brady to the major league team.
2024-04-15The Colorado Pirates have acquired John Brady from the waiver wire.
2024-04-01The Minnesota Mavericks have promoted Scott Wade to the major league team. The Minnesota Mavericks have promoted Walt McIvor to the major league team. The Minnesota Mavericks have promoted Bill Pendleton to the major league team. The Minnesota Mavericks have waived John Brady. The Minnesota Mavericks have waived Harry Dixon. The Minnesota Mavericks have waived Hank Eden. The Minnesota Mavericks have waived Frank Powell. The Minnesota Mavericks have waived Eddie Nicol. The Minnesota Mavericks have waived Jack Vedder. The Minnesota Mavericks have waived Newt Johnson. The Minnesota Mavericks have waived Chad Crowley.
2023-08-10A trade has been completed between the Montreal Canadiens and the Minnesota Mavericks. The Minnesota Mavericks receive Gary Northrup, John Brady from the Montreal Canadiens in exchange for Orlin Podres, Scott Christopher. Protest This Trade.
2023-08-03The Montreal Canadiens have promoted John Brady to the major league team. The Montreal Canadiens have sent Scott Kantlehner to the minors.